Problem

Existing optical fingerprint imaging systems face inefficiencies in light use and instability of the light source, affecting image capturing performance.

Innovation Solution

The system incorporates a mounting element to fix the light source to a lateral side or end portion of a substrate, eliminating gaps and ensuring a stable position, allowing light to enter directly into the substrate, enhancing light efficiency and stability.

PatentUS9892307B2Optical fingerprint imaging system and optical assembly thereof
Publication Date: 2018.02.13 SHANGHAI OXI TECH

An optical fingerprint imaging system and an optical assembly are provided. The optical fingerprint imaging system includes: a sensor including a substrate and a photosensitive layer, wherein the substrate has a first surface and a second surface which is opposite to and lower than the first surface, and the photosensitive layer is in contact with the first surface of the substrate; a light source disposed at a position lower than the first surface and higher than the second surface, and light emitted from the light source is adapted to be guided by the substrate of the sensor to the first surface of the substrate; and a mounting element adapted to mount the light source at a fixed position. Accordingly, the optical fingerprint imaging system has high light use efficiency and stable light source.
